How to Use This Collection Effectively
Step 1: Browse by Category, Not by Popularity
While popular prompts are popular for good reason, your best results will come from matching the prompt category to your specific need. A food photographer shouldn’t default to the most-viewed prompt if it’s a shoe commercial.
Step 2: Read the Full Prompt Before Using It
On VideosPrompt, click into each prompt to see the full text. Understanding why a prompt works — the specific language about lighting, camera movement, timing — will make you a better prompt writer over time.
Step 3: Adapt, Don’t Just Copy
The prompt collection is a starting point. Change the product, swap the environment, adjust the mood. The structural elements (camera direction, lighting descriptors, pacing instructions) transfer across use cases.
Step 4: Iterate Based on Output
Use the first generation as a diagnostic tool. What came out right? What needs adjustment? Refine the prompt and regenerate. Most professional AI video creators produce 3-5 iterations before they’re satisfied.

Model-Specific Considerations
Not all AI video models respond to prompts the same way. Here’s what to know:
Veo 3.1 excels with detailed scene descriptions and cinematic language. It responds well to references to specific film techniques. Check the Veo 3.1 prompting guide for model-specific tips.
Seedance 2.0 offers powerful control over motion and style. The Seedance prompting guide covers advanced techniques for getting the most from this model. For free, ready-to-use prompts, explore this Seedance 2.0 prompts collection.
Kling, Sora, and Runway each have their strengths. Kling excels at realistic human motion, Sora at creative compositions, and Runway at stylized aesthetics. Many prompts in the VideosPrompt collection work across multiple models — the community often notes which models produce the best results.
Hailuo and MiniMax H3 are strong contenders for short-form content, with fast generation times that make iteration practical.
Building Your Personal Prompt Library
Organize by Use Case
Create your own categorized collection based on the types of videos you produce most often. Bookmark prompts that work for your specific niche — whether that’s e-commerce product shots, restaurant marketing, or social media storytelling.
Track What Works
Keep notes on which prompts produce the best results with your preferred AI model. What works on Veo might need tweaking for Seedance. Your personal library should include these model-specific notes.
Stay Current
The AI video space evolves weekly. New models launch, existing models update, and prompt techniques that worked yesterday might be outperformed by something new tomorrow. Check VideosPrompt regularly for the latest community-tested prompts.
Learn the Patterns
Over time, you’ll notice patterns in successful prompts: specific camera language, lighting descriptors, timing instructions, and mood-setting phrases. These patterns are transferable skills that make you a better prompt engineer regardless of which tool you use.
